Output 60c86c355b0a78d3f5207f43c6fa5ed2c2c36a82022904368e0dba085829ad67:23

value
40144268
script pubkey
OP_0 OP_PUSHBYTES_20 1458779e6df637e035e9ea886154c95d9a7fa9be
address
bc1qz3v808nd7cm7qd0fa2yxz4xftkd8l2d779gwr8
transaction
60c86c355b0a78d3f5207f43c6fa5ed2c2c36a82022904368e0dba085829ad67
confirmations
276771
spent
true